IN THE HIGH COURT OF KERALA AT ERNAKULAM PRESENT THE H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E AMIT RAWAL WEDNESDAY, THE 12TH DAY OF FEBRUARY 2020 / 23RD MAGHA, 1941 WP(C).No.4006 OF 2020(A) PETITIONER/S: THE KANICHUKULANGARA SERVICE CO-OPERATIVE BANK LTD.NO.1179KANICHUKULANGARA.P.O,ALAPPUZHA-688582,REPRESENTED BY ITS SECRETARY. BY ADVS.SRI.C.A.JOJOSMT.SWATHY S. RESPONDENT/S: 1INCOME TAX OFFICERWARD-5,OFFICE OF THE INCOME TAX OFFICER, A.N.PURAM,ALAPPUZHA,PIN-688011. 2COMMISSIONER OF INCOME TAX(APPEALS),OFFICE OF THE COMMISSIONER OF INCOME TAX, KOTTAYAM-686002. OTHER PRESENT: SC CHRISTOPHER ABRAHAM THIS WRIT PETITION (CIVIL) HAVING COME UP FOR ADMISSION ON12.02.2020, THE COURT ON THE SAME DAY DELIVERED THE FOLLOWING: JUDGMENT Petitioner has approached this Court seeking adirection to dispose of Ext.P3 appeal preferred before thesecond respondent/Commissioner of Income Tax (Appeals)against the assessment order Ext.P1. 2.Having heard the learned counsel on both sides, thewrit petition is disposed of with a direction to the secondrespondent to take a decision on Ext.P3 appeal in accordancewith law, after affording an opportunity of hearing to thepetitioner, within a period of three months from the date ofreceipt of a copy of this judgment. Till such time a decision istaken on the petitions, recovery proceedings shall be kept inabeyance. sab Sd/- AMIT RAWAL JUDGE APPENDIX PETITIONER'S/S EXHIBITS: EXHIBIT P1 A TRUE COPY OF THE ASSESSMENT ORDER FO AY2017-18 DATED 12.12.2019 ISSUED BY THE FIRST RESPONDENT EXHIBIT P2 A TRUE COPY OF THE DEMAND NOTICE U/S 156 DATED 12.12.2019 ISSUED BY THE FIRST RESPONDENT EXHIBIT P3 A TRUE COPY OF THE APPEAL FOR AY 2017-18 BEFORE THE 2ND RESPONDENT DATED 22.01.2020 EXHIBIT P4 A TRUE COPY OF THE NOTICE ISSUED BY THE 1ST RESPONDENT DATED 04.02.2020 FOR 20% OF TAX.
